Summary: | Indonesia is a country with high biodiversity, one of them is kalong
kapauk {Pteropus vampyrus). Kalong kapauk is one of the wild animal that is
caiagorized suificient population still available in the wild (CITES, Appendix II),
and according to IUCN as near threatened Kalong kapauk have an unique
behavior whiih eat and sleep hanging to the branch of tree and head position
below the body, this requires a high balance. The cerebellum is the part of the
brain that regulates the body's balance, and it is interesting to study histology of
cerebellum kalong kapauk. The aim of this study to determine the cerebellum
histology kalong kapauk to complete anatomy information of Indonesia wildlife
animal.
This study used five kalong kapauk that from Central Java. Cerebellum
procesed for histological preparations by paraffin blocks, then cut preparation
piece 12pm then performed Cressyl Violet staining. Staining results were
bbserved using a microscope equipped with digital camera and analyzed in a
description using software Adobe Photoshop CS2, Microsoft ffice excel and
Optilab Image Raster.
